Ralf Rangnick’s preferred next Man United’s manager Revealed

Ralf Rangnick’s choice of manager to take over from him at Manchester United has been revealed.

Despite reports of the club being in secret contact with Paris Saint-Germain’s Mauricio Pochettino, the Argentine is not Rangnick’s preferred successor.

Ralf Rangnick was given the privilege to make the choice of who succeeds him at the club when he leaves next summer.

Pochettino, Erik ten Hag of Ajax and Leicester City’s Brendan Rodgers are top on the list of managers lining up for the job

French outlet, Le Parisien reports that Rangnick prefers Ten Hag to take over the reins at Old Trafford and he is a huge fan of the 51-year-old.

Ten Hag has transformed Ajax in recent seasons making them play scintillating football and they joined an exclusive club this season by winning all six of their Champions League group games.

Le Parisien also reported that PSG are braced for the possibility of losing Pochettino in the summer and will move to bring in Zinedine Zidane as his replacement.
